How to Make a Website Fast and Easy

1:30 pm by admin. Filed under: Internet And Businesses Online




Anyone can make a website these days using the services and products readily available to us all. But for a first-time web master, it can be a slow and frustrating process, as you figure out how everything works, what is compatible with what else and how everything slots together.

A simple website can easily go from nothing to a finished, published site in less than a day *if* you know what you’re doing. Otherwise it can take weeks if not longer – and that assumes you get finished at all!

So in this article we’re not just going to look at how to make a website, we’re going to be more specific and consider how to make a website fast and easy so you can get your site online sooner rather than later.

Okay, well the good news is that with all the software and services around at the moment there is a greater chance to make a website fast and easy than ever before.

Let’s take a look at some of the resources that will help you achieve this…

1) WordPress

You can use WordPress software free of charge to make a blog super-fast. Within minutes you’ll have a basic website set up for you to tweak when you have time. Add some articles and you’re done.

2) Blogger

Google’s offering for bloggers offers a similar service to WordPress though differs being easier to use but less fully-featured.

3) Nvu

Nvu free web design software lets you make a website easily on your home computer without splashing out cash.

4) Free Website Templates

Whether you decide to make a website from scratch using software like Nvu or using an online blogging solution like WordPress or Blogger you will be able to find a host of free site templates that you can either use as-is , or modify to perfectly suit your needs.

A quick search in your favorite search engine will likely turn up hundreds of sites listing these template files.

5) CoolText

Allows you to create your own logo free of charge. Just visit the site, type in your website name, select the color, the font and so on and out pops your finished logo. What’s more, they look great!

6) Royalty Free Images

Websites like IstockPhoto allows you to get royalty-free images to use on your website so you can add professionally-photographed pictures, animations and cartoons to your site, without breaking the bank or risking a letter from a solicitor.

7) Low Cost Web Hosting

There is plenty of competition in the market now for web hosting. If you’re wondering how to make a website fast and easy, then select a budget web hosting company to host your site. Then consider using WordPress or Blogger to actually build a site, together with a free template to give it a professional look. You can be set up for under $5 a month with this solution, including your own website address.

The end result is fantastic and it’s quick and easy to set up. This is my own personal favourite technique for making a website fast.

How to Get Started With a New Blog and Blog Designs

12:39 am by admin. Filed under: Internet And Businesses Online




There are a couple things that every blogger must do when first getting started. No matter if you are blogging for fun or for profit follow these steps to get your blog started off on the right foot.

One – Spend some time configuring every part of your blog. There’s nothing worse than having done 99% of the work, only to be let down by the final 1%. To make sure that your blog will get the most traffic possible make sure you read over all the options and fill in all the forms in your admin panel. This includes any profile fields and any plugin information that is needed. Many plugins require you to fill in a lot of information before you can even use them. You may want to read the documents on WordPress.org so you know the best ways to fill everything out.

Two – Set up your blog designs. You can pick one of the themes that everyone else has and upload it. But making your blog stand out from the rest is extremely helpful in keeping your visitors coming back. Plus when you design it yourself you will get a feeling of ownership and it will make it easier for you to work on it. Another reason you may want to use a custom blog design is because it keeps your blog from looking like spam. Most spam bloggers do not customize their blogs at all but the ones that do just use templates and they fill in as little personal info as possible.

Three – Content, content and more content. You will want to start writing your posts as soon as possible. You do not have to publish them all at once but just write five posts to start then set up auto posting for every other day or so. One of the biggest things that Google looks at, when ranking your site, is how often you have new content. Also be sure you use your keywords in your title and at least once within the first paragraph. Then once you have your five posts written create your categories so the your posts are easy to find.

Four – Promote your content. After you have written a good amount of content you will need to promote that content. There are lots of ways to do this and it could take you a long time if you were to try them all. Just focus on the ones that will bring you the most traffic. I would recommend adding a plugin like Sexy Bookmarks so that your readers can submit your content to bookmarking sites. This will save you time and give you a great traffic boost. Another important form of promotion is article marketing. You should write a couple of articles and submit them to sites like EzineArticles, Squidoo or Hub Pages. You can also submit your site to a bunch of search engines and directories. This can take a lot of time but it is free and can bring you a lot of traffic.

Five – have fun! This is the most important thing of all. Just have fun with blogging because if you enjoy writing your blog posts it is very likely that your readers will enjoy it as well. So just have some fun with it.

Blogging, ultimately, is about connecting with your readers and gaining an audience for your work. It also allows you to express yourself, make friends, and help people by sharing your expertise. Even if you are blogging for your business it is still all about connecting. So go out and connect with your readers!

3 Ways to Make Money With Your Blog

4:27 pm by admin. Filed under: Internet And Businesses Online


If you would like to start bringing in money just by running your own blog you may want to consider these money making ideas:

1. If you do not mind posting small reviews of products on your blog, then payperpost.com may be enticing to you. You just sign up with them and they will provide you with links to promote to your blog. Once they verify that you have placed the link in a post, they pay you, it’s that easy.

2. One of the biggest moneymakers these days for Webmasters is placing Google adsense ads on their sites and blogs. If you have a WordPress blog, then all you have to do is download the plug-in through a site like wordpress-plugins.biggnuts.com and sign up for Google adsense. Once you are ready to go you just plug-in a small code that Google gives you and you will get paid every time someone clicks on the ads.

3. Another very popular ways to make money with your blog or website is by promoting affiliate links. Affiliate links are provided by companies that will pay you a certain percentage of each sale made through your unique link. Just go to any popular company website and sign up for their affiliate or partner program. Most of them are free to sign-up and very easy to implement.

The above techniques can really bring in a nice extra income if your blog is getting daily visitors. Don’t let the potential pass by. You can continue to enjoy posting on your blog and enjoy some extra money at the same time.

Alternatively, you can refer others to Google adsense and various affiliate programs and get paid for that as well. There is an unlimited income potential for those willing to take action and implement these moneymakers.

If this sounds appealing, but you do not have any visitors coming to your blog, then start promoting it. Blog promotion is very easy and anyone can do it. Just do a Google search for ‘blog directory’ and post your blog to as many as possible. Go to OnlyWire.com and social bookmark every post you make. Just using these two promotion techniques can drive a lot of targeted traffic to your blog.

How to Start a Blog That Makes Money

5:59 am by admin. Filed under: Internet And Businesses Online




Here’s how to have a blog that makes money. As with virtually everything else in Internet marketing having a blog that makes you money is a combination of the two main Internet marketing ingredients; targeted traffic and a good, compelling offer. You can start your blog for free using blogger or one of the other free blogging platforms out there, but I don’t recommend it for two main reasons.

The first reason that I would eschew free blogging platforms, such as Blogger, is that when your blog is hosted on Blogger, the domain, traffic and content is theirs, not yours. Google, who owns Blogger, really doesn’t need any more free hands up, do they?

The second reason that you should steer clear of free blog hosting platforms when you’re building your blog empire business is that, because of the first reason, you’re not building your business, you’re actually helping to build someone else’s.

The first thing you should do when starting a blog that you hope will bring in a healthy income for you one day is actually plan things out. That’s right; you should actually sit down for a few hours and make a business plan. That will help make sure you don’t miss any of the details you’ll need to be successful. Be sure you include everything, such as what the main theme of your blog will be, the monetization strategies you’ll use, a financial plan, a growth plan, and an oft forgotten part of many business plans, the exit strategy.

Most highly successful blogs are tightly themed. That means they focus closely on a certain subject or niche, such as local residential real estate, working from home income techniques, ’60′s muscle cars, or needlepoint. This focus will help you build a core base of loyal readers and subscribers. These are very important for the immediate and long term success of your blog. In addition, having a large, vibrant subscriber list adds a large amount of value to your blog should you want to sell it. If you’re having trouble choosing a theme, look for one with a large profit potential. There will be more on this later.

Decide on what you’ll call your blog and get your own domain name. These are very affordable, and will help you sidestep the problems of using a free hosting platform. You will own the domain and will be free to do with it as you please. You blog will actually be an asset that you control.

The next decision you’ll have to make is what blogging platform you’ll use. The two largest are Movable Type and WordPress. WordPress is open source, meaning basically it’s free. Because it’s open source, many developers freely create things for WordPress, so there are a huge number of add-ons, widgets, templates, and plugins available for it. You can even publish your WordPress blog from your iPhone now!

Movable type is not open source, but you may still be able to get it free, as many web hosting companies offer it as part of the hosting package. It too has many different things available to enhance the functionality and appearance of blogs published with it. I’ve used both frequently. You can have many fantastic, and profitable blogs with either publishing system.

So you’ve got your blog up and you’re posting to it with reckless abandon. How can you make some money for your efforts? That’s sort of a balancing act. You want to blog about a topic that interests you, or keeping up an aggressive posting schedule will become very difficult. You also want to blog about a topic that is profitable, or you won’t make any money.

To help find what blog subjects can earn you some decent profits, head to Google and see what keywords are going for these days. Use the free Google keyword tool in Google Adwords. You can type in keywords and keyword phrases and the tool will show an estimate of cost per click that advertisers are willing to pay for ads targeting a given keyword or phrase, and an idea of the number of advertisers that are advertising using them.

Keywords that are relatively expensive and have substantial competition mean that many advertisers are willing to pay fairly large amounts of money for those keywords. In theory that means that there is profit to be made by creating content that features those keyword phrases.

Remember that it is only an idea, and there are two schools of thought on earning money from your blog. You can try to find a narrow niche with little competition, and dominate it. The other approach is to head to a very large, but profitable niche and try to get enough traffic to skim some profit from the niche. Basically you’ll either a small fish in an ocean, or a large fish in a pond. There are successful bloggers using both strategies.

Next you’ll want to decide on a monetization strategy for your blog. In most cases you’ll use a combination of them to bring home the bacon. The three main strategies are:

1) Sales of your own products or services
2) Affiliate marketing
3) Advertising. This is usually contextual advertising, but some bloggers are successful with other forms, such as banner ads.

With affiliate marketing you’ll be paid a commission for referring a visitor to a company’s site. If the person you referred does the desired action you’ll earn your commission. In the majority of cases the desired action means the visitor buys something, or fills out a lead form.

Contextual advertising automatically places ads on your site that are targeted to your site by the context of your site. The ad publishers have algorithms that look at your blog and decide which of their advertiser’s ads would best go with your blog’s content. In most cases, you’re then paid a percentage of the advertising fee when one of your visitors clicks on the link in the ad. This is known as pay per click advertising. The leader is this is Google, with their AdWords / AdSense program.

To have a blog that makes money, you need to have targeted traffic, the more the better. That is largely a function of the content. A large amount of good, original content (not content scraped form other blogger’s RSS feeds). Some on page search engine optimization techniques won’t hurt either, but good, high quality content will get you both search engine visitors, and repeat traffic from people that just want to read your stuff.

Make sure you target the proper keywords in your posts and post titles. You’re looking for profitable keywords that have relatively low competition. By optimizing for words and phrases people are actively searching for, you’ll do better in the search engine rankings, and you’ll be giving your readers exactly what they were looking for. That double whammy is a true recipe for blog money making success.
